Responsibilities include but are not limited to:
Candidate will be responsible for providing diagnostic and therapeutic treatment to adult/geriatric populations with an array of differentiating diagnosis'.
Candidate will evaluate and provide treatment to individuals with speech, language, cognition, voice, fluency and swallowing disorders.
Candidate will be responsible for completing all pertinent and necessary documentation.
Candidate will be responsible to participate in the interdisciplinary team by attending staff/family meetings.
Candidate will be responsible for reporting to Supervisor on a daily basis.
What Candidate Needs:
· Master’s Degree in Speech-Language Pathology from an accredited College Institution
· If fully Licensed SLP must have Clinical Competence Certification (CCC)
· CPR Certification
· Malpractice Liability Insurance
· If fully Licensed SLP must have current New York State License and Registration AND or if Clinical Fellow-temporary permit number
· Experience of at least 1 year in Skilled Nursing Facility/Rehabilitation Center/Outpatient Rehab/Hospital preferred
· Experience (Externships and/or Work Experience) in Acute/Sub-Acute Care or related medical setting with Adult/Geriatric populations
